Transaction 99cd39463a9e15f424801b53d1bfce136fc8631f711631c9ff57095f4b402642
1 Input
1 Output
-
99cd39463a9e15f424801b53d1bfce136fc8631f711631c9ff57095f4b402642:0
- value
- 156346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0b3a7101dc72833b49e2b14c36a39584c508a8d OP_EQUAL
- address
- 3GLjFiZXnbg35YLmcKacgazNxNzptJ2BsY